Revascularization in peripheral vascular disease: stents, atherectomies, lasers, and thrombolytics

Peripheral vascular disease (PVD) involves vessel occlusion. Treatments like angioplasty and thrombolytics open blocked vessels, with nurses crucial for minimizing complications during and after interventions.

Area of Science:

  • Vascular Medicine
  • Interventional Cardiology

Background:

  • Peripheral vascular disease (PVD) is a common condition.
  • Vessel occlusion, caused by plaque, dissection, or thrombus, leads to PVD symptoms.

Purpose of the Study:

  • To review current interventions for peripheral vascular disease.
  • To highlight the role of nurses in managing PVD patients.

Main Methods:

  • Review of percutaneous transluminal angioplasty (PTA) as an independent intervention.
  • Discussion of adjunctive therapies including stents, atherectomy, and laser treatments.
  • Examination of thrombolytic therapy for acute and chronic occlusions.

Main Results:

  • Percutaneous transluminal angioplasty is effective for opening occluded vessels.
  • Nonsurgical therapies can be combined with PTA for enhanced outcomes.
  • Thrombolytics are a viable option for various types of occlusions.

Conclusions:

  • Interventional therapies offer effective solutions for PVD.
  • Comprehensive patient monitoring by nurses is essential for successful outcomes and complication avoidance.
